For the bath, you dose 5ml per gallon. I use a 5-gallon bucket, with an air-stone and small heater. Make sure the bath is up to temp and aerated before adding the fish and for the duration of the 90-minute bath.

It’s pretty well tolerated in my experience, but still check on the fish periodically for signs of stress.

After the bath, I think I’d really try to get him eating before any other treatments. You can continue the epsom salt for swelling, but if he doesn’t start to eat soon I don’t think he will have much of a chance at recovery.

His chance for recovery is much better now that he’s eating! There is a good possibility he might lose that eye, But at this point there’s not much else you can do for that and since he is finally eating I wouldn’t want to try another round of medication and risk suppressing his appetite.

If you have vitamins or selcon to add to his food, I would do that to boost his immune system. If he suddenly stops eating again, you might consider another course of antibiotics. Otherwise, just keep offering small amounts multiple times a day, and hope for the best!
